I went out shopping today and spotted a nice building in Chester. I lined up the camera and noticed the lens was set at 50mm so I decided to give the "Nifty Fifty" a whirl....Half clicked for the focus got the all clear and fire!........Nothing? I have had this with flat batteries but they were new so after some investigation I tried the 24-105mm and all was fine. Refited the 50mm and realise the AF has stopped working. In MF the camera fired fine. Turning the focus ring it felt rough and gritty as if the lens was full of sand, Which it aint!
So at £50-£60 for a new lens, is it worth getting this one fixed or just buy a new one?
